The Pensive Poet
Written, August 1, 2026 (My 87th Birthday)
For The Contest, “The Pensive Poet”
Sponsor: Constance La France ~ 1st Place
"The Past and Present show the score;
unknown if the Future will hold more."
__by Poet
There comes a time when future seems to fade,
since space for that is limited by age,
and pensive thoughts about it are oft laid
aside in cherishing each former stage.
Reviewing both the present and the past
brings thankfulness for what was then and now,
as memories rebuild thoughts meant to last
and current time will add to them somehow.
I pause to think about and honor this-
the was and is, I cannot ask for more.
Some sadness too, but mostly there was bliss
which splashed upon my past and present shore.
My future will unfold what's meant to be.
For now, my past and present have blessed me.
